Enhancing Access Control in Healthcare Blockchain Using LSTM-Based Breast Cancer Detection and Blowfish Encryption
Abstract
By providing a secure and transparent platform for the exchange and storage of medical records, blockchain technology revolutionizes data management in the healthcare sector. Patient record confidentiality and integrity are ensured by this decentralized system, which forbids unauthorized access and tampering. Smart contracts speed up processes like insurance claims and simplify administrative work by enabling automated, trustless transactions. Additionally, blockchain facilitates seamless data- sharing by facilitating communication between various healthcare systems. Through a distributed ledger, medical professionals can access a patient’s whole medical history in real time, facilitating better diagnosis and treatment. Despite challenges like regulatory worries, blockchain’s potential for the healthcare industry holds promise for improved patient outcomes, security, and efficiency ( Kumar et al., 2021 ).
